Abstract
The utility model relates to an electronic ballast, in particular to an infrared adjustable light electronic ballast which comprises an electromagnetic interference (EMI) filter, a rectifying circuit,a power factor correction circuit, an infrared sensing control circuit, a dimming circuit, an output level circuit and a fluorescent lamp. By combining an infrared technology and a dimming technology, the infrared adjustable light electronic ballast can be applied to a dimming electronic ballast of the fluorescent lamp, so as to lead the dimming of the fluorescent lamp to be more intelligent andovercome the defect of poor intelligent degree of the existing ballast; furthermore, the electronic ballast can be taken as a lighting subsystem to be embedded into a building automatic control system, and has wide application prospect on family intelligence and large public places.

Background technology
Fluorescent lamp is as a member in the gaseous discharge lamp family, and its appearance has had the history of decades.Because good photoelectricity usefulness and cheap cost of manufacture, fluorescent lamp has become a kind of popular lighting source.The negative resistance charactertistic of fluorescent lamp, make must have corresponding current limiting device to match could operate as normal, this flow restricter is exactly a ballast.Fluorescent lamp the startup stage be to injure electrode most, use the fluorescent lamp of Inductive ballast, fluorescent tube of every startup is equivalent to fluorescent tube approximately and lighted continuously two hours.Therefore, frequent switch fluorescent lamp is the life-span that influences very much fluorescent lamp.Raising day by day along with the energy efficient requirement, also for fear of the frequent switch of fluorescent lamp, dimmable electronic ballast arises at the historic moment as a kind of energy-conserving product, and the intelligent degree of dimmable electronic ballast in the market is not high, also the dimmable electronic ballast that does not combine with the infrared induction technology.

Embodiment
The design philosophy of infrared dimmable electronic ballast is that the infrared induction technology is applied to control dim signal by infrared signal in the intelligent dimming.When the people walked close to, infrared sensor captured human infrared signal, and this signal is transferred to light adjusting circuit, made that fluorescent lamp is complete bright state by the low-light level state-transition; When nobody the time, fluorescent lamp is in the low-light level state always.So just reduced the number of times of switch fluorescent lamp.The infrared induction technology is applied to really realize intelligent dimming in the light adjusting system of fluorescent lamp.
Below in conjunction with accompanying drawing the utility model is further described:
As shown in Figure 1, infrared dimmable electronic ballast comprises electromagnetic interference (EMI) filter 1, rectification circuit 2, circuit of power factor correction 3, infrared induction control circuit 4, light adjusting circuit 5, output-stage circuit 6, fluorescent lamp 7, wherein:
Exchanging input is connected with output-stage circuit 6 through electromagnetic interference (EMI) filter 1, rectification circuit 2, circuit of power factor correction 3 successively;
Infrared induction control circuit 4 is connected with output-stage circuit 6 through light adjusting circuit 5;
The output of output-stage circuit 6 connects fluorescent lamp 7.
Output-stage circuit is that output-stage circuit produces the pulse that two-way does not overlap to the half-bridge driven of light adjusting circuit, is used for driving the half-bridge inverter in the light adjusting circuit.
Light adjusting circuit is a dimming control signal to the feedback of output-stage circuit, this signal produces error current through dimmable electronic ballast special chip internal error amplifier, the operating frequency of control half-bridge inverter, and then pass through the brightness that the LC series resonant circuit is controlled lamp.
Introduce the function of each several part below in detail:
1, electromagnetic interference (EMI) filter
The technical measures that suppress EMI have shielding, ground connection (floating ground, single-point ground and ground network) and filtering.Wherein, filtering technique is to suppress the effective and the most most economical means of conducted interference.Because various interference are the most serious at the system interface place, so electromagnetic interface filter is placed on the porch of system power supply line.The conducted interference of AC power cord comprises differential mode noise composition and common-mode noise composition.In order to play the effect that suppresses to disturb, reduce noise, adopt the alternating current circuit electromagnetic interface filter.Electromagnetic interface filter had both suppressed common mode and differential mode interference from electrical network, guaranteed that common-mode noise and differential mode noise do not appear in secondary side.Simultaneously, it also plays attenuation to the electromagnetic interference that electric ballast self produces, and is not contaminated to guarantee electrical network.
2, rectification circuit
By rectifier bridge the alternating current of importing is carried out rectification, output DC.
3, circuit of power factor correction
Cross when low when power factor, power supply equipment is not fully utilized, and causes the huge waste of electric energy, influences the normal operation of power consumption equipment.And can in the current supply line of building, produce heat.The power factor of electric ballast is low can to limit the load of household electrical appliance, even can increase lighting expense usefulness.So circuit of power factor correction is essential.
4, infrared induction control circuit
The infrared induction control circuit is applied in the middle of the dimmable electronic ballast, and is connected, realize real intelligent stepless dimming with light adjusting circuit.
5, light adjusting circuit
Input infrared induction control signal is input to the current potential of dimmable electronic ballast special chip according to this signal scalable, and then controls the brightness of fluorescent lamp.
6, output-stage circuit
What adopt is to be the voltage input half-bridge inverter of load with the fluorescent lamp, and the direct voltage of its input is the output voltage of circuit of power factor correction.Wherein the frequency of dimmable electronic ballast special chip driven MOS FET pipe about with 40kHz alternately cut-off, and like this, just produced high frequency square wave at the half-bridge circuit mid point.Fluorescent lamp is in off state before startup, choke induction and startup electric capacity, capacitance have just been formed the LC series resonant circuit like this.
The voltage of dimmable electronic ballast special chip circuit VDC end and the VCC end directly rectifier bridge output voltage from circuit of power factor correction is obtained.The light modulation of fluorescent lamp is adopted the method for phase control.When preheating and trigger mode, circuit LC high frequency series resonance, the electric current and voltage phase difference of resonance point is ± 90 °, operating frequency is a little more than resonance frequency.Light-modulating mode, inductance L in the circuit and RC series connection in parallel, phase difference is little when high-power, and phase place is inverted during small-power.So during the operational mode after the triggering, input current and half-bridge output voltage phase difference are to change between 0 °-90 °, wherein, the corresponding maximum power of zero phase difference.The output of hot so outer induction control circuit has potential change, and the phase place of load current will Back Up, thereby power output changes, and has realized the light modulation of dimmable electronic ballast special chip circuit to brightness of fluorescent lamp.
